Good to Know
Always use safety glasses when driving roll pins – they can pop out unexpectedly once they break loose. Start with light taps to get the pin moving, then increase force gradually. If a pin is really stubborn, a few drops of penetrating oil and some patience usually does the trick better than heavy hammering.
